O*NET-SOC Description
Assemble, install, alter, and repair pipelines
or
pipe systems that carry water, steam, air,
or
other liquids
or
gases. May install heating and cooling
equipment
and mechanical control systems. Includes sprinkler fitters.

Tasks
Operate
motorized pumps to remove water from flooded manholes, basements,
or
facility floors.
Assemble pipe sections, tubing,
or
fittings, using couplings, clamps, screws, bolts, cement, plastic solvent, caulking,
or
soldering, brazing,
or
welding
equipment.
Attach pipes to walls, structures,
or
fixtures, such as radiators
or
tanks, using brackets, clamps, tools,
or
welding
equipment.
Cut
openings
in structures to accommodate pipes
or
pipe fittings, using hand
or
power tools.
Inspect structures to assess material
or
equipment
needs, to establish the sequence of pipe installations,
or
to plan installation around obstructions, such as electrical wiring.
Install fixtures, appliances,
or
equipment
designed to reduce water
or
energy consumption.
Install green plumbing
equipment
, such as faucet flow restrictors, dual-flush
or
pressure-assisted flush toilets,
or
tankless hot water heaters.
Lay out full scale drawings of pipe systems, supports,
or
related
equipment
, according to blueprints.
Maintain
or
repair plumbing by replacing defective
washers
, replacing
or
mending broken pipes,
or
opening
clogged drains.
Modify, clean,
or
maintain pipe systems, units, fittings,
or
related machines
or
equipment
, using hand
or
power tools.
Weld small pipes
or
special piping, using specialized techniques,
equipment
,
or
materials, such as computer-assisted welding
or
microchip fabrication.
